LNG seafarer training by KLMA Japan, “LNG Sigtto Standard Training Course”, was certified by DNV GL in 2007 to confirm that it adapts to the international seafarers training standard.
The course has recently been brought online, adding to the conventional face-to-face training. The certification range has also been enlarged. This is the first certification by DNV GL for online seafarers training in Japan.
“K” Line states that is places KLMA Japan at the core of its seafarers training system. By adopting the "Online" method, “K” Line has established a training system that eliminates the risk of infection due to the movement of trainees and face-to-face lectures during the COVID-19 pandemic. This enables the company to maintain safety in navigation, which is fundamental to its business operations
